The Best Vietnamese Vegan Dishes to Try

Vietnamese cuisine is renowned for its vibrant flavors and fresh ingredients, making it a paradise for vegan food lovers. The variety of plant-based options available allows anyone to enjoy the rich culinary traditions of Vietnam without compromising dietary preferences. Here, we explore some of the best Vietnamese vegan dishes you must try.

1. Pho Chay (Vegetarian Pho)
One of the most famous Vietnamese dishes, Pho is usually made with meat, but the vegetarian version, Pho Chay, is just as delightful. This aromatic soup features rice noodles in a savory vegetable broth, infused with herbs like basil and cilantro. Loaded with fresh veggies such as bean sprouts, mushrooms, and bok choy, Pho Chay is both comforting and satisfying.

2. Goi Cuon (Fresh Spring Rolls)
Goi Cuon, also known as fresh spring rolls, offers a refreshing snack or appetizer. These rolls are made with rice paper and filled with a variety of fresh vegetables, herbs, and tofu. They are often served with a tasty peanut or hoisin sauce for dipping, making them a perfect light meal or starter.

3. Bun Thit Nuong Chay (Vegan Grilled Noodle Salad)
This delicious dish features rice vermicelli topped with seasoned and grilled tofu, fresh herbs, and crispy veggie toppings. The dish is drizzled with a sweet and sour dressing made from lime juice, sugar, and soy sauce, providing a perfect balance of flavors. Bun Thit Nuong Chay is a refreshing and filling option for lunch or dinner.

4. Dau Hu Sot Ca Chua (Tofu in Tomato Sauce)
This classic Vietnamese dish, Dau Hu Sot Ca Chua, is a delightful combination of crispy tofu cubes simmered in a savory tomato sauce. The sauce is enhanced with garlic, onion, and fresh herbs, and it is often enjoyed with steamed rice. It's a wholesome meal that showcases the rich flavors of Vietnam without any animal products.

5. Banh Mi Chay (Vegan Banh Mi)
Banh Mi is a beloved Vietnamese sandwich known for its perfect balance of flavors and textures. The vegan version, Banh Mi Chay, typically features marinated tofu, pickled vegetables, fresh cilantro, and chili peppers, all stuffed inside a crunchy baguette. This portable meal is great for lunch or a quick snack on the go.

6. Che Ba Mau (Three-Color Dessert)
No meal is complete without dessert, and Che Ba Mau is a must-try. This colorful dessert features layers of mung beans, jelly, and coconut milk, topped with crushed ice. The combination of textures and flavors makes it a refreshing treat, especially on a hot day.

7. Rau Muong Xao Toi (Stir-Fried Water Spinach)
The dish Rau Muong Xao Toi showcases the natural flavors of water spinach. Stir-fried with garlic and a splash of soy sauce, this simple yet flavorful dish is often served alongside rice. It’s a popular vegetable dish in Vietnam and a great way to enjoy fresh greens.

8. Mi Quang Chay (Vegan Quang Noodles)
This regional specialty from Central Vietnam, Mi Quang Chay, features flat rice noodles in a fragrant broth made from vegetable stock. Often topped with tofu, fresh vegetables, and peanuts, it offers a unique and delicious combination of textures and flavors.
